The M2000 Underwater Modem is an underwater acoustic modem designed for reliable communication and scientific data acquisition in demanding subsea environments. Encased in a machined aluminum housing and depth-rated to 2000 m, the M2000 is ideal for vehicles, moorings, and research systems requiring robust construction, flexible integration, and dependable acoustic performance.

M2000 Features:

  • Long-Range Acoustic Communication: 1–8 km depending on conditions and modulation selected.
  • Flexible Data Rates: 80 bps to 10,240 bps depending on the selected modulation scheme.
  • Single Sideband Voice: Integrated analog SSB voice communications capability.
  • Precise Acoustic Ranging: Two-way acoustic ranging with accuracy better than <0.3 m.
  • 100 W Acoustic Output: High transmit power for demanding communication links.
  • Easy System Integration: Ethernet, RS-422, RS-232, and programmable Linux APIs.
  • Onboard Data Logging: High-capacity storage with waveform playback and recording capability.

System Electronics Options:

  • PMM5544 - Standard: Dual-core processing, 64 GB storage, proven balanced performance.
  • PMM6081 - High-Performance: Quad-core processing, 128 GB storage, enhanced compute capability and autonomy.

Optional Specialized Features (License Required):

  • JANUS Support: Enables interoperable underwater communications using the NATO ANEP-87 standard.
  • Phorcys Stheno: Adds secure Phorcys communications capability in the 20–28 kHz operating band.
  • MARIA: Unlocks the Marine Acoustic Rapid Innovation Architecture for custom acoustic algorithms, PCM data access, and advanced hardware control.
